Question:

Which one of the following is wrong?
The elements on the main diagonal of a symmetric matrix are all zero
The elements on the main diagonal of a skew - symmetric matrix are all zero
For any square matrix $A, \frac{1}{2}(A + A')$ is symmetric matrix
For any square matrix $A, \frac{1}{2}(A - A')$ is skew - symmetric matrix

Step-by-Step Solution

Key Concept: General
The elements of main diagonal of skew symmetric matrix are all zero but not necessarily for symmetric matrix. $\Rightarrow \frac{A + A'}{2}$ is symmetric matrix. $\Rightarrow \frac{A - A'}{2}$ is skew symmetric matrix.
Correct Answer: A
